Thursday, February 11, 1988 Earthquake

The earthquake hit Papua New Guinea on Thursday, February 11, 1988 at 23:41 UTC with a magnitude of 5.1. The closest known location in the current dataset is Lae (Papua New Guinea - PG), about 281.3 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 149.540 and latitude -6.694.
